To maintain the homogenisation efficiency of the Miris Ultrasonic Processor, it
is important to clean and polish the probe after each use. Homogenisation ef-
ficiency is determined by the capability of the probe to transmit energy into the
milk, and this capability will degrade in proportion to the degree of roughness of
the tip surface. Any erosion of the probe tip, visible as dark spots or a ring round
the outer edge of the tip, must therefore be removed by careful polishing with
fine grit emery cloth. Polish off the eroded part only and no more, or the probe
will wear out quicker.
Wipe spillages immediately. Clean the instrument surface and inside using a cloth
dampened with Miris Cleaner™.
If necessary, a mild disinfectant can be used to clean the probe and the instrument
surfaces.
Wipe off the probe after every milk sample using a tissue.
Clean the probe with a cloth dampened with Miris Cleaner™ after finishing for
the day.
Polish the tip (the flat end) of the probe with an emery cloth after each use.
Make sure to polish the probe evenly, avoiding bevelled edges, and to complete-
ly remove any milk residues, see Figure 5.
